What you show in Image 2 is normal. That is just due to how we draw the data. What is happening is if the values have not changed then the drawing is drawn forward, but if the initial value is off the screen, then you will see the blanks like you are seeing at some levels.

But what was odd in your video was that there was data missing over the entire area on the left, not just a few missing blocks. We are pretty sure this is why you are seeing the flashing, as it is trying to update that area, so you see some of the drawings coming in and out, but we are trying to understand the reason why you would have that occur in the first place.

Is there something in particular that occurs that causes that entire left side to be blank? Do you happen to notice a particular pattern that causes it?
